630 Frames- A poem

After 630 frames,

Now I’m accepting myself It has taken time, many years, people and 630 frames.

Dripping with self-love, Trusting the greatest power,

Withdrawing and prioritizing my need for the solitude and my higher self.

It purely took the wisdom, the faith & the virtue of letting go.

Now, it’s finally the time to accept.

After 630 frames,

I’m accepting myself It has taken time, many years, people and 630 frames.

-

630 frames is a metaphor being used in this poem, meaning being different than self and trying to fit in.
